Boss reveals that Cooper declared himself fit at the last minute to face the Cumbrians
Steve Davis revealed that our Boxing Day goalscorer George Cooper was not going to play after struggling with a groin strain on Christmas Eve.
The Alex staff had planned to go without their potential match winner due to his injury set-back, but the youngster declared himself fit to face Carlisle and was rewarded with his sixth goal of the season from a deal ball situation. Cooper planted home a perfect 25 yard free-kick to cancel out Shaun Miller’s opening goal in a Boxing Day feast.
Boss Steve Davis told crewealex.net: “George wasn’t going to play against Carlisle. He had a problem with his groin in the build-up to the game and we had planned to play without him, but he declared himself fit, said it was feeling better and that he wanted to play.
“I am glad he did because he has that ability to score from dead ball situations. He has shown it before and I’m pleased he scored a free-kick of that quality to get us back in the game. We deserved it. “
